Modeling of laterally loaded piles using embedded beam elements
Model lateralno opterećenih šipova pomoću „umetnutih“ grednih elemenata
Abstract
Realistic modeling of pile groups requires the use of complex nonlinear 3D simulations, usually with full discretization of pile continuum. In order to reduce the complexity of these models, as well as the computation time, in past years an embedded beam element has been formulated and implemented into FEM computer codes such as PLAXIS 3D. This concept was originally intended for modeling axially loaded piles and pile groups, while its performances under lateral loading conditions are not fully investigated. This paper presents the overview of different modeling techniques of laterally loaded pile groups using FEM. The possibility of using embedded beam model for this problem, as well as its limitations, have been discussed.
